加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.zhandada.cn/)- 应用程序、大数据、数据可视化、人脸识别、低代码!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

Linux小程序开发:高效工具链与一键部署指南

发布时间:2026-01-29 16:14:07 所属栏目:Linux 来源:DaWei
导读:  Linux环境下进行小程序开发,可以借助一系列高效的工具链来提升开发效率。常见的工具包括GCC编译器、Make构建系统以及版本控制工具Git。这些工具能够帮助开发者快速完成代码编写、编译和测试流程。   在开始开

  Linux环境下进行小程序开发,可以借助一系列高效的工具链来提升开发效率。常见的工具包括GCC编译器、Make构建系统以及版本控制工具Git。这些工具能够帮助开发者快速完成代码编写、编译和测试流程。


  在开始开发前,建议配置好开发环境。可以通过包管理器安装必要的依赖库,例如使用apt-get或yum来安装开发工具链。同时,确保系统更新至最新版本,以避免兼容性问题。


  编写小程序时,推荐采用模块化设计,将功能拆分为独立的源文件。这样不仅便于维护,还能提高代码复用率。使用Makefile来管理编译过程,可以简化多文件项目的构建流程。


  部署阶段需要考虑目标系统的兼容性。通过交叉编译生成适用于不同架构的可执行文件,或者直接在目标系统上进行编译。使用静态链接可以减少依赖问题,提高程序的可移植性。


  一键部署可以通过脚本实现,例如编写Shell脚本自动完成编译、打包和传输过程。结合rsync或scp工具,可以快速将程序部署到远程服务器。同时,使用systemd或init.d管理服务,确保程序在系统启动时自动运行。


AI分析图,仅供参考

  持续集成(CI)也是提升开发效率的重要手段。通过GitHub Actions或Jenkins等工具,可以实现代码提交后自动构建和测试,确保代码质量。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章